Hardware Knowledge Hall: Talking about Boiler Water Level Safety Control
| 2014-11-21

1. Foreword Whether the industrial boiler is safe, the most important thing is:

1. Ensure that the boiler water level is normal;

2. Ensure that the boiler pressure is within the rated range. Before using the industrial boiler, first check whether the "boiler water level alarm" is installed. If it is not installed, it cannot be used under any conditions. Otherwise, huge economic losses may be caused, and the responsible person will touch the law.


Second, the classification of industrial boiler water level alarms can be divided into:

1. Floating ball boiler water level alarm

2. Magnetic control boiler water level alarm

3. Electrode boiler water level alarm

4. Unit combination instrument type alarm


Third, the advantages and disadvantages of various types of boiler water level alarms

(1) Advantages of floating ball boiler water level alarm:

1. The alarm is not affected by water quality, suitable for any water quality, and there is no scaling problem.

2. Simple structure.

3. Less affected by water level fluctuations.

shortcoming:

1. The cost is high. The water level controller + water level alarm is generally about 2,000 yuan. If the display on the console and the sound and light alarm part are added, it will cost at least 2,500 yuan.

2. Because this type of alarm is a mechanical displacement motion control, there are phenomena such as friction and stuck.

3. Maintenance is complicated.

4. The mercury switch is easy to be damaged and the maintenance cost is high.

5. The operating pressure is low, and the maximum is generally not greater than 3.8MPa.


(2) Advantages and disadvantages of magnetic control boiler water level alarm:

1. The alarm is not affected by water quality, suitable for any water quality, and there is no scaling problem.

2. Simple structure.

3. Less affected by water level fluctuations.

shortcoming:

1. The cost is high, and a set of boiler water level display control alarm generally costs more than 2,500 yuan.

2. Because this type of alarm is a mechanical displacement motion control, there are phenomena such as friction and stuck.

3. The maintenance is complicated, and it is difficult for the user to maintain it by himself.

4. The reed switch is easy to be damaged and the maintenance cost is high.

5. The operating pressure is low, and the maximum is generally not greater than 3.8MPa.


3. Advantages and disadvantages of electrode boiler water level alarm

advantage:

1. The cost is low, and the complete set is equipped with multi-functional "boiler water level alarm" such as display control alarm chain, and the price is within 1,000 yuan.

2. Simple structure and easy maintenance.

3. Long service life, generally can share the same life with the boiler.

4. Complete functions, with water level display, water level control, high and low water level alarm, limit low water level alarm chain protection, boiler pressure overpressure alarm and its chain, control and other functions in one.

5. Suitable for any pressure boiler, the maximum pressure can reach 30MPa (300Kg).

shortcoming:

1. Affected by water quality, there is a scaling problem.

2. It is greatly affected by the fluctuation of water level.

3. Vulnerable to external interference.


4. User selection According to different situations of various users, the above three boiler water level alarms have their own advantages and disadvantages. For high-pressure boilers, only electrode-type boiler water level alarms can be used, because it is especially suitable for high-pressure boilers. For small and medium-sized enterprises, it should be preferred, float type boiler water level alarm and electrode type boiler water level alarm, for the shortcomings of electrode type boiler water level alarm:

1. Affected by water quality, there is a scaling problem.

2. It is greatly affected by the fluctuation of water level.

3. Vulnerable to external interference. At present, Tianjin Security Boiler Instrument Factory has successfully developed a new type of multi-function boiler water level alarm, which effectively overcomes the above shortcomings.

1. For the problem of scaling due to the influence of water quality. The plant adopts pulsating exchange nonlinear asymmetric signal voltage, low current, and conduction current at the microamp level (10μA), which has effectively overcome the scaling phenomenon caused by water quality problems.

2. For the problem that is greatly affected by the water level. The factory adopts the current relatively advanced anti-interference technology, implements intelligent filtering technology, effectively prevents the interference source from entering the system, and truly solves all kinds of interference problems.

3. The problem of being easily disturbed by the outside world, especially the problem of being easily disturbed by the frequency converter, is the most difficult problem to solve for this type of instrument. On this issue, after hundreds of experiments, the factory finally launched a "UDZ-141X-G multifunctional boiler water level display and control alarm" this year. The advent of the alarm has effectively solved the problem of external interference. This type of instrument adopts the follow-up tracking technology. When there is no interference signal, the system is in an alert state, when a weak interference signal appears, the system is in a filtering state, and when a strong interference signal appears, the system is in a blocking state. This enables interference-free operation.
